Plant oils can be extracted through various methods, such as cold pressing, steam distillation, or solvent extraction. Cold pressing involves crushing the plant material to release the oils. Steam distillation uses steam to extract the oils from the plant material. Solvent extraction involves using a chemical solvent to separate the oils from the plant material.

What are the most important types of extraction process in pharmacognosy?

The most important types of extraction processes in pharmacognosy are maceration, percolation, Soxhlet extraction, and steam distillation. Maceration involves soaking the plant material in a solvent to extract the desired compounds. Percolation uses gravity to move the solvent through a column of plant material. Soxhlet extraction continuously cycles the solvent through the plant material. Steam distillation utilizes steam to extract essential oils from plant material.

What is the process for extracting essential oils called?

The process for extracting essential oils is called steam distillation. It involves passing steam through plant material to vaporize the essential oils, which are then condensed and collected. This method is commonly used to extract essential oils from various plants and herbs.


All essential oils are made from a base of?

Essential oils in general are produced by steam distillation or hydraulically pressing some part of a plant. For lemons, the rinds are pressed to extract the oils. For rose otto, the flower petals are picked before 8am then distilled with water to extract the oils. You also have chemical extraction methods which can pull out the essential oils, resins, and waxes out of the plants. For blending, many people use a base oil. Sometimes it is a carrier oil i.e. - jojoba, avocado, etc.; sometimes it is another more mild essential oil such as lavender.
